Clive Bingwa is a power player in the Perth region and was named managing director of Initiative Perth in 2015 in addition to his role as managing director of IPG Mediabrands in the region. Prior to joining IPG Mediabrands in 2015, Mr Bingwa was a partner and led media at full-service agency 303 Mullen Lowe for 16 years.
